Zhiyun Weebill 3S Gimbal — All-Day Stabilization With a Built-In Fill Light
The gist: A professional 3-axis gimbal with an 11.5-hour battery, 3 kg payload, and a built-in 1000-lux fill light — a self-contained travel filmmaking rig that replaces multiple accessories.
- Full-day battery life: Dual 2600 mAh batteries deliver up to 11.5 hours of runtime, with PD fast charging to full in ∼2 hours — genuinely usable across a full day of travel shooting without hunting for a power outlet.
- 3 kg payload for mirrorless and lightweight DSLRs: Handles most mirrorless cameras with lenses comfortably; the upgraded sling grip adds low-angle versatility for creative travel framing without additional rigs.
- Built-in 1000-lux fill light: Adjustable 2600–5500K fill light on the body means one fewer accessory to pack for golden-hour portraits or low-light travel shots — a meaningful packing advantage.
- 360° pan, 310° tilt, 340° roll: Full-range stabilization axes cover everything from walking shots to overhead filming without rebalancing constantly.
Digital Camera World's review calls the Weebill 3S a “safe bet for your first professional gimbal,” highlighting the 11-hour battery and built-in fill light as the standout differentiators over competing models in the price bracket.
Best for: Travel videographers and adventure creators who want a capable, single-kit gimbal without add-on lighting or spare batteries slowing them down. Skip it if: You regularly carry cinema-grade cameras over 3 kg — a heavier-duty gimbal (RS3 Pro or Ronin series) will be needed. Runs ~$319 — check the current price before buying.
